If you are writing a resume to apply for a position as a trucker, there are several key aspects you must include:
1. Contact Information
Include your full name, contact number, address for email and your location (including the city as well as state). This information is required to be displayed prominently at the top of your resume, so employers are able to easily reach out to you.
2. Objective Statement or Professional Summary
Include an objective or professional summary which briefly outlines your career goals and highlight your relevant skills and experiences as a truck driver. This section must be adapted to the job you are applying for.
3. License and Certifications
Check all the relevant permits and certifications that you’ve obtained as a truck driver. This could include a commercial driver’s license (CDL) and endorsements for vehicles that are specialized (such as hazardous materials) or safety training certifications.
4. Professional Experience
Provide your employment history in reverse chronological order starting with your most recent job. Include the name of the company along with the dates of employment, the job title as well as a brief summary of your responsibilities and accomplishments. Focus on highlighting any relevant experience driving trucks or transporting goods.
5. Skills
Create a separate section to highlight your most important capabilities as a truck driver. Include any technical knowledge for example, operating different types of trucks and making use of GPS navigation systems. In addition, you should mention soft skills such as time management, attention to detail and good communication skills.
6. Education
Provide your education background with any relevant certificates or degrees. In the list, include the address of your institution, the dates of attendance, and also the diploma or degree you have earned.

What should I include on my resume for a truck driver?
In your truck driver resume it is essential to include your contact information, summary or objective, pertinent capabilities (such as a knowledge of particular routes or the equipment) and work history, including the previous positions you have held and any licenses or certifications you hold (such ones such as CDL) and any awards or praises you’ve been awarded. It is important to tailor your resume to highlight the abilities and experiences that are best suited to the specific job that you’re applying for.
Can I make use of a template that is generic for my truck driver resume?
While using a generic template may be appealing however, it is recommended to personalize your resume specifically for each job application. Employers like resumes that are customized to their particular needs. Utilizing a template that is generic could cause your resume to appear more personalized and less attractive to potential employers. By personalizing your resume, you can demonstrate the ways in which your experience and skills match the requirements of the truck driving position.
Do I require a cover letter to apply to a truck driving job?
Indeed, a well-written cover letter is highly recommended when applying for a job as a truck driver. A cover letter is a way to introduce yourself and point out key aspects of your background which make you an ideal candidate. It provides employers with additional information into who you are as an individual and the reason you’re interested in this position. Use the cover letter as occasion to highlight any gaps in employment, or give additional information about your qualifications.
